Brampton recruit determined to “see the field” early on at Bishop’s (VIDEO)

Brampton linebacker/defensive end joins RSEQ team’s 2016 class.

In the quest to make an early impact at the CIS level, Anthoine Walker is moving provinces to achieve his main goal.

The 6’4, 220 pound linebacker/defensive end from Brampton, Ontario committed to Bishop’s Gaiters.  Walker will join the team for the 2016 RSEQ season.

“I picked Bishop’s for many different reasons,” explained the defensive standout.  “Mainly, academically for the small campus and classroom sizes, giving me a better chance to have more one on one time with the professor.”

“With athletics, I have a chance to make a big impact coming in to a team that won two games in the past two seasons. Also the small roster gives me a better chance to see the field early in my university career.”

In 2015, Walker helped the St. Roch Ravens of the Region of Peel Secondary School Athletic Association (ROPSSAA) win their historical first ever OFSAA Bowl this past November.  During the fall season, the defensive standout recorded four sacks, registered 26 tackles and had a pick-six.
